Output d53eec2be365439fea60fa1266ea021f7691cb0144efaefad0dfdd86b7feb26c:3

value
109581
script pubkey
OP_0 OP_PUSHBYTES_20 9e64d7b75db4fcf26ec37b83356481dbd40f4a3b
address
bc1qnejd0d6akn70ymkr0wpn2eypm02q7j3mtywxd7
transaction
d53eec2be365439fea60fa1266ea021f7691cb0144efaefad0dfdd86b7feb26c
confirmations
18455
spent
true